Syntax:
Syntax refers to the rules for writing code. It includes everything from variables and operators to function definitions and control structures. Syntax determines how programs work and what data is processed. Proper syntax prevents errors and makes the program easier to read and understand.
Best Practices:
Best practices guide developers on how to write effective and maintainable code. They focus on simplicity, readability, and maintainability. Some common best practices include using meaningful variable names, avoiding unnecessary repetition, and breaking down complex problems into smaller, manageable parts.
Programming Language:
There are many programming languages available, each with their own unique syntax and features. The most commonly used languages include Python, Java, C++, JavaScript, and Ruby. Each language has its strengths and weaknesses, so choosing the right language depends on your needs and preferences.
